Serious Sam II (2005) is a fast-paced action game that doubles down on the franchise's signature formula of overwhelming enemy hordes and relentless combat. This indie shooter tasks players with battling through diverse environments—from thick jungles to frozen wastelands and futuristic cities—while taking down the villain Mental and his time-traveling forces. The game is known for its intense arcade-style gameplay that prioritizes non-stop action over strategic cover-based shooting.
